In seismic-wave migration imaging, the conjugate-transpose matrix stands for the back-propagation of the observed wavefield. Therefore, the wavefield propagators are the basis for seismic-wave imaging.
For constructing a wavefield propagator, we introduce the following methods: (1) a hybrid wavefield propagator, that is, the split-step-Fourier propagator plus optimal interpolation with a self-adaptive reference velocity choice; and (2) a local and directional wavefield propagator, which can be designed with the local Fourier transform and local plane wave/Gaussian beam, for target-oriented imaging (, , ).
